Cody, William F. "Buffalo Bill" (1846-1917), Western scout, furnished buffalo meat for Union Pacific construction crews, actor, Wild West showman and impresario. 6½ x 4½ photograph wearing his trademark fringed buckskins and hat, inscribed and signed "W. F. Cody / "Buffalo Bill" / June 21st 1907/ to James Brown Thornton". Matted with 2pp. (separate leaves) Nov. 1, 1960 interesting TLS by, and on letterhead of, antiquarian firearms dealer F. Theodore Dexter recounting meeting Cody and his horse and talking of Cody's personality. Dexter letter is waterstained but legible, however his signature is mostly penciled in. Handsomely matted and framed to 20 x 34 overall.
